Structural fo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the condition of the foundation to identify problems such as cracking, shifting, or settling. Once the issues are diagnosed, contractors may employ various techniques to stabilize and reinforce the foundation, including underpinning, piering, or slabjacking. The goal is to restore the foundation’s strength, prevent further damage, and ensure the safety and longevity of the structure.
Many foundation problems st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ction practices, or aging materials. These issues can lead to uneven settling, c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. Addressing foundation concerns early can prevent more extensive damage to the property’s structure and interior. Professional foundation repair services are equipped to provide solutions that improve the stability of the building and mitigate the risk of future issues caused by ongoing soil or environmental factors.
Properties that commonly require foundation repair include resid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ive soils. Commercial buildings, such as retail centers or office complexes, may also need foundation stabilization to maintain safety and operational integrity. Additionally, multi-family dwellings, garages, and other structures built on problematic soil types may benefit from foundation reinforcement.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. For minor issues, costs may be closer to $2,000, while extensive repairs could reach $10,000 or more.
Type of Repair and Pricing - The cost varies based on the repair method, with underpinning averaging around $3,000 to $6,000. Piering or mudjacking might cost between $1,000 and $4,000, depending on the project size.
Material and Accessibility Factors - Costs are influenced by the materials used and accessibility of the foundation, with concrete underpinning typically costing $4,000 to $8,000. Difficult-to-access areas may increase labor costs, raising the total estimate.
Location and Service Area - Prices can fluctuate based on local market conditions, with services in Meriden, KS, and nearby areas generally falling within the $2,500 to $9,000 range for typical foundation repairs. Larger or more complex projects t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can range from a few days to a couple of weeks.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? The level of disruption depends on the repair type, but experienced service providers aim to minimize impact, often completing work with limited disturbance to daily activities.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il settlement or expansion,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, and t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or cracks early can help reduce the risk of future problems. Consulting local pros for assessment is recommended.
